Island businessmen set out to spread the word
Bermuda will be going as far a-field as Egypt to attract e-commerce business to the Island.
A small contingent of Bermuda businesses will preach the value of operating from the Island, in a road show that will take them to Tel Aviv, Dublin and London in November.
The Bermuda Stock Exchange (BSX), the Island's largest law firm, Appleby, Spurling & Kempe (AS&K) together with telecommunications provider TeleBermuda and investment bankers Voyager Financial Services, will team up for the project entitled `B2B. Bermuda'.
The team will hold a half-day seminar in each of the cities.
"We want to reach the mind and management behind e-com, high-tech and bio-tech start-ups,'' said BSX CEO William Woods.
"We want to attract those businesses with a solid business plan that want to expand globally.'' AS&K earlier this year became the first local law firm that allowed online incorporation of offshore companies.
"Bermuda offers the regulatory legal and business environments necessary for such companies to thrive and prosper,'' said Warren Cabral AS&K partner and practice leader of the firm's intellectual property and information technology department.
"Bermuda is at the forefront of the Internet revolution, having introduced legislation last year -- the Electronic Transaction Act 1999 -- that gives legal substance to electronic data and transactions negotiated over the Internet.
Mr. Cabral also noted that Bermuda is the first government to institute a Ministry for e-commerce and that there are no taxes on capital gains or income.
TeleBermuda will boast fast connection speeds and digital capability, during the seminars, proving to attendees that the Island has a sophisticated telecommunications infrastructure.
"We are working to make Bermuda the hub of international e-commerce and telecommunication services, '' said James Fitzgerald TBI's general manager.
The team touting the `Bermuda Advantage' will hold seminars on November 23 in Tel Aviv at the Intercontinental Hotel, on November 27 at Dublin's Hilton Hotel and on November 29 in London at the Knightsbridge Hilton.
